## Local Setup: Deep-Link Routing

The Skylark deep-link router maps `wrenly://` URLs to app screens via a route table synced from the backend. For local work, run `make routes-dev` to start the stub resolver and install the dev build on a simulator. Route changes require a table version bump or clients ignore them. The resolver reads the route table from the shared database using the connection string below.

database URL for fawig-tagag: cockroachdb://briwyn_svc:xY@db-f6f3.xolmartech.local:5432/kelius

Welcome aboard. Brindlecast is our chattiest service, so we sample aggressively: debug logs at 1%, info at 10%, warnings and errors unsampled. Plugin authors sometimes assume full log capture and file false-positive bug reports when their debug lines don't appear — please explain sampling before digging in. If you genuinely need full fidelity, you can raise the sampling rate per-tenant for up to one hour. The sampling configuration reference and override procedure are documented on the internal page below.

wiki page, yafop-fadup: https://jira.qorvelsys.internal/projects/display/projects/pages

## Break-Glass: Mutewell Deduplicator

If Mutewell starts swallowing real pages (it's collapsed distinct incidents before), support can flip it into passthrough mode without waiting for platform on-call. Heads up: this will get noisy fast, so warn the duty engineer in the incident channel first. Break-glass access lasts 60 minutes and is logged, reviewed weekly, and occasionally mocked in retro. To activate, open the admin panel, choose "Emergency Passthrough," and when prompted for verification, enter the recovery passphrase shown just below.

vault phrase of yagag-kadup = belael-druius-rusax-kelox